Did we finally get our answer on the Trouba NTC?!?!
Yeah, I posted the answer with links to the MOU about this a few weeks back.

All upcoming NTC/NMC clauses that are set to become active during the 2020-2021 season were negotiated to begin during the FA period, whenever that was determined (which is now known to be October 9th), instead of the normal FA start of July 1st.
